Handover — cold-storage archiving (Frostbin)

For review: the branch moves expired buckets from warm tier to Frostbin cold storage, with manifests written before deletion. Check the retry logic around partial uploads — that's the risky bit. Dry-run mode is default; live runs need the ops flag. To verify against the sealed test archive, unlock it with the recovery passphrase below.

strongbox words: prawyn-fenmir

- [ ] Step 7: Archive cold storage buckets (Glacierline tier). Confirm both ceremony witnesses are present, verify bucket manifests match the Oxbow ledger, then seal the archive key shares. Plugin authors may observe but not handle shares. Once sealed, the archive index itself is encrypted and can only be reopened with the passphrase below.

vault phrase of badup-hahig = tamael-aldael-kelmir-istael-fenok-istwyn-tamius-jorath-oliion

## Lost Badge Procedure

If you misplace your contractor badge while on site at Quillstone Park, report it immediately to the reception desk in the Atrium, where a member of the Dunmore Security team will deactivate it within minutes. Do not attempt to follow another person through a controlled door in the meantime. You will be escorted to the security office to verify your details and sign a replacement form. While your new badge is printed, you may use the temporary visitor pass code provided below.

staff pass of kawip-hawef = bdg-QLP-2

Subject: On-call notes — tax-rate cache

Welcome to the rotation. Quick facts about the Ferndell tax-rate lookup cache: it refreshes hourly from the rates service, entries expire after six hours, and a stale-but-serve fallback kicks in if the upstream is down. Most pages are cache-miss storms after a region rollout — warm the cache manually, don't restart the service. Never flush during business hours without approval from the payments lead. Warmup commands, alert thresholds, and the escalation path are on the internal page below.

wiki page, hahif-hahif: https://argocd.kelvisys.corp/browse/board/settings/pages/1442e0b1065d83f1